Yoshitaka Imura is a scholar working on Rheumatology, Epidemiology and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Yoshitaka Imura has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 1.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 26 papers in Rheumatology, 14 papers in Epidemiology and 12 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Yoshitaka Imura’s work include Eosinophilic Disorders and Syndromes (12 papers), Inflammatory Myopathies and Dermatomyositis (11 papers) and Systemic Lupus Erythematosus Research (8 papers). Yoshitaka Imura is often cited by papers focused on Eosinophilic Disorders and Syndromes (12 papers), Inflammatory Myopathies and Dermatomyositis (11 papers) and Systemic Lupus Erythematosus Research (8 papers). Yoshitaka Imura coll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and The Netherlands. Yoshitaka Imura's co-authors include Tsuneyo Mimori, Ran Nakashima, Koichiro Ohmura, Hajime Yoshifuji and Naoichiro Yukawa and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Scientific Reports and FEBS Journal.
